Mercy has been announced as the winner of the 2019 Big Brother Naija Reality show after she became the woman standing and one of the five finalists.
Recall that five housemates made it through the 99th day of the reality show and they are Frodd, Omashola, Mercy, Seyi and Mike.
The Imo-born reality show star took home the N30m cash prize, a brand new car and other gifts which makes up her winning to N60m. Mike who is the first runner-up was also announced as the winner of the arena games for having the best time, and he took home N2m cash prize.
Mercy is now the first female housemate to win the reality show as its previous winners have all been male housemates.
The 2019 edition of the Big Brother Naija Reality show had over 240 million votes and over 50 million votes were recorded in the last week of the reality show.
